<h2 id="establishing-a-maintenance-and-redesign-timeline">Establishing a Maintenance and Redesign Timeline</h2>
<p>To guarantee your website remains effective and aligned with your evolving business goals, establishing a clear maintenance and redesign timeline is essential. Schedule regular content refreshes to keep information current, engaging, and optimized for search engines.</p>
<p>Incorporate branding updates thoughtfully to ensure visual consistency and reflect your latest brand identity. A technical audit every 6 to 12 months helps identify performance issues, security vulnerabilities, and usability gaps.</p>
<p>For minor tweaks, set quarterly reviews, while major redesigns might occur every 2-3 years, depending on industry shifts or digital trends. By creating this structured timeline, you proactively address changing user expectations and technological advancements, maintaining a dynamic online presence that supports your growth and competitive edge in Raleigh’s vibrant market.</p>

<h2 id="neglecting-user-experience-and-accessibility">Neglecting User Experience and Accessibility</h2>
<p>Neglecting user experience and accessibility can considerably undermine a website&#8217;s effectiveness, especially during a redesign. You must prioritize elements like color contrast to ensure readability for all users, including those with visual impairments.</p>
<p>Insufficient contrast between text and background can alienate users, reducing engagement and trust. Additionally, keyboard navigation is critical; ignoring it hampers accessibility for users who rely on keyboards rather than mice.</p>
<p>Without logical tab order and visible focus states, navigation becomes frustrating and exclusionary. Strategic attention to these details enhances usability for everyone, prevents legal compliance issues, and broadens your audience.</p>

<h2 id="overcomplicating-navigation-and-site-structure">Overcomplicating Navigation and Site Structure</h2>
<p>Overcomplicating navigation and site structure can substantially hinder user experience by making it difficult for visitors to find the information they need efficiently. Excessive menu complexity creates confusion, discouraging exploration and increasing bounce rates.</p>
<p>To avoid this, prioritize hierarchy clarity by organizing content logically, with clear categories and intuitive pathways. Overly nested menus or redundant links can overwhelm users and obscure important pages.</p>
<p>Striking the right balance involves simplifying menu options without sacrificing depth, ensuring key sections are easily accessible. Strategic labeling and consistent structure help users predict where to find information.</p>
<p>Ultimately, a streamlined navigation system improves usability, encourages engagement, and reflects thoughtful planning—essential qualities for a successful web redesign.</p>

<p>As you plan your redesign, keep in mind that responsive design is non-negotiable. Your website should deliver an ideal experience regardless of device—desktop, tablet, or smartphone. This flexibility directly impacts user experience, as visitors expect seamless access to your content without frustrating delays or layout issues.</p>
<p>Additionally, optimize load times through efficient coding and image compression, since slow sites drive visitors away. In your strategy, don’t overlook accessibility standards—make sure your site is usable for all, including those with disabilities. Incorporate features like alt text for images and keyboard navigation to broaden your reach and demonstrate your commitment to inclusivity.
